WebSep 3, 2024 · Due to the intrinsic brittleness of Mo-Si, the alloying has limited improvement in the mechanical aspect. Thus, it is hard to use Mo-Si series compounds for the components fabrication. Grain refinement is a vital technique which benefits the strength, toughness, and oxidation resistance of Mo-Si-based alloys.
